    Thanks MoneymanMaz. I'd read the quarterly a number of times before I learnt the stages of the EPA over the weekend & saw Arions YouTube link.

    I found this table in my archive that someone posted awhile back. I've updated it with each stage including an additional 2-4 weeks grace period each as we're dealing with bureaucratic red tape and Cinnabon's ignorance.

    This might answer Carna's post about when we see production starting - I'd punt a mid-late 2025 based on this table. Once ASN is up and running I think a 200m MC would be conservative and doesn't account for Muchea or ASC. So we'd be looking at ~5x bags in 1.5 years at current prices.

    It would be difficult to say how much investors would price in Muchea, as it COULD still be 3-4 years away if the EPA decide to assess due to varying vegetation and it's proximity Perth.

    I'd hope that the high grade Silica sand being listed as a critical minerals list for the shift to renewables and (hopeful) success of VDT at ASN will help + the proposed overhaul of review process - but who knows.

    Keep in mind this table doesn't account for the possibility of EPA sending us back to the Rts stage again to make themselves feel important. We'd be reamed if this happened. I've also assumed DAWE(now DAFF) have been included throughout the EPA and don't have to review once ministerial sign off provided.

    RE: Financials - Recent quarter spend was ~900k total, after this raise there'll be ~3.6m in the coffers. This will take us 3 quarters to the end of year including the current. If it goes smoothly, we could see EPA approval and offtakes before the next CR is required. Cinnabon's "offtakes before Christmas" may finally hold some weight this year.

    Having done a deep dive on VRX over the weekend - I still see the huge potential value in VRX at current prices particularly with Delphi on board, but this comes with prominent risk. Investors need beware that these are very real risks that include insolvency as had occurred in Bruce's last Tiwi island project.

    IMO & DYOR of course
